Introduction to 1 Thessalonians
THIS is the first of all the epistles which St. Paul wrote.
Thessalonica was one of the chief cities of Macedonia. Hither St.
Paul went after the persecution at Philippi: but he had not
preached here long before the unbelieving Jews raised a tumult
against him and Silvanus and Timotheus. On this the brethren sent
them away to Berea. Thence St. Paul went by sea to Athens, and
sent for Silvanus and Timotheus to come speedily to him. But
being in fear, lest the Thessalonian converts should be moved
from their steadfastness, after a short time he sends Timotheus to
them, to know the state of their church. Timotheus returning
found the apostle at Corinth from whence he sent them this
epistle, about a year after he had been at Thessalonica. The parts
of it are these:
I. The inscription, Chap. i, 1
II. He
A. Celebrates the grace of God towards them,. 2-10
B. Mentions the sincerity of himself and his fellowlabourers, ii. 1-12, And the teachableness of the Thessalonians, 13-16
III. He declares,
A. His desire, 17-20
B. His care, iii. 1-5
C. His joy and prayer for them, 6-13
IV. He exhorts them to grow,
A. In holiness, iv.1-8
B. In brotherly love with industry, 9-12
V. He teaches and exhorts,
A. Concerning them that sleep, 13-18
B. Concerning the times, v.1-11
VI. He adds miscellaneous exhortations, 12-24
VII. The conclusion, 25-28
